// Diff line types.
const (
	DIFF_LINE_PLAIN = iota + 1
	DIFF_LINE_ADD
	DIFF_LINE_DEL
	DIFF_LINE_SECTION
)

const (
	DIFF_FILE_ADD = iota + 1
	DIFF_FILE_CHANGE
	DIFF_FILE_DEL
)

type DiffLine struct {
	LeftIdx  int
	RightIdx int
	Type     int
	Content  string
}

func (d DiffLine) GetType() int {
	return d.Type
}

type DiffSection struct {
	Name  string
	Lines []*DiffLine
}

type DiffFile struct {
	Name               string
	Addition, Deletion int
	Type               int
	Sections           []*DiffSection
}

type Diff struct {
	TotalAddition, TotalDeletion int
	Files                        []*DiffFile
}

func (diff *Diff) NumFiles() int {
	return len(diff.Files)
}

const DIFF_HEAD = "diff --git "

func ParsePatch(reader io.Reader) (*Diff, error) {
	scanner := bufio.NewScanner(reader)
	var (
		curFile    *DiffFile
		curSection = &DiffSection{
			Lines: make([]*DiffLine, 0, 10),
		}

		leftLine, rightLine int
	)

	diff := &Diff{Files: make([]*DiffFile, 0)}
	var i int
	for scanner.Scan() {
		line := scanner.Text()
		// fmt.Println(i, line)
		if strings.HasPrefix(line, "+++ ") || strings.HasPrefix(line, "--- ") {
			continue
		}

		i = i + 1

		// Diff data too large.
		if i == 10000 {
			return &Diff{}, nil
		}

		if line == "" {
			continue
		}
		if line[0] == ' ' {
			diffLine := &DiffLine{Type: DIFF_LINE_PLAIN, Content: line, LeftIdx: leftLine, RightIdx: rightLine}
			leftLine++
			rightLine++
			curSection.Lines = append(curSection.Lines, diffLine)
			continue
		} else if line[0] == '@' {
			curSection = &DiffSection{}
			curFile.Sections = append(curFile.Sections, curSection)
			ss := strings.Split(line, "@@")
			diffLine := &DiffLine{Type: DIFF_LINE_SECTION, Content: line}
			curSection.Lines = append(curSection.Lines, diffLine)

			// Parse line number.
			ranges := strings.Split(ss[len(ss)-2][1:], " ")
			leftLine, _ = base.StrTo(strings.Split(ranges[0], ",")[0][1:]).Int()
			rightLine, _ = base.StrTo(strings.Split(ranges[1], ",")[0]).Int()
			continue
		} else if line[0] == '+' {
			curFile.Addition++
			diff.TotalAddition++
			diffLine := &DiffLine{Type: DIFF_LINE_ADD, Content: line, RightIdx: rightLine}
			rightLine++
			curSection.Lines = append(curSection.Lines, diffLine)
			continue
		} else if line[0] == '-' {
			curFile.Deletion++
			diff.TotalDeletion++
			diffLine := &DiffLine{Type: DIFF_LINE_DEL, Content: line, LeftIdx: leftLine}
			if leftLine > 0 {
				leftLine++
			}
			curSection.Lines = append(curSection.Lines, diffLine)
			continue
		}

		// Get new file.
		if strings.HasPrefix(line, DIFF_HEAD) {
			fs := strings.Split(line[len(DIFF_HEAD):], " ")
			a := fs[0]

			curFile = &DiffFile{
				Name:     a[strings.Index(a, "/")+1:],
				Type:     DIFF_FILE_CHANGE,
				Sections: make([]*DiffSection, 0, 10),
			}
			diff.Files = append(diff.Files, curFile)

			// Check file diff type.
			for scanner.Scan() {
				switch {
				case strings.HasPrefix(scanner.Text(), "new file"):
					curFile.Type = DIFF_FILE_ADD
				case strings.HasPrefix(scanner.Text(), "deleted"):
					curFile.Type = DIFF_FILE_DEL
				case strings.HasPrefix(scanner.Text(), "index"):
					curFile.Type = DIFF_FILE_CHANGE
				}
				if curFile.Type > 0 {
					break
				}
			}
		}
	}

	return diff, nil
}

const prettyLogFormat = `--pretty=format:%H%n%an <%ae> %at%n%s`

func parsePrettyFormatLog(logByts []byte) (*list.List, error) {
	l := list.New()
	buf := bytes.NewBuffer(logByts)
	if buf.Len() == 0 {
		return l, nil
	}

	idx := 0
	var commit *git.Commit

	for {
		line, err := buf.ReadString('\n')
		if err != nil && err != io.EOF {
			return nil, err
		}
		line = strings.TrimSpace(line)
		// fmt.Println(line)

		var parseErr error
		switch idx {
		case 0: // SHA1.
			commit = &git.Commit{}
			commit.Oid, parseErr = git.NewOidFromString(line)
		case 1: // Signature.
			commit.Author, parseErr = git.NewSignatureFromCommitline([]byte(line + " "))
		case 2: // Commit message.
			commit.CommitMessage = line
			l.PushBack(commit)
			idx = -1
		}

		if parseErr != nil {
			return nil, parseErr
		}

		idx++

		if err == io.EOF {
			break
		}
	}

	return l, nil
}

// SearchCommits searches commits in given branch and keyword of repository.
func SearchCommits(repoPath, branch, keyword string) (*list.List, error) {
	stdout, stderr, err := com.ExecCmdDirBytes(repoPath, "git", "log", branch, "-100",
		"-i", "--grep="+keyword, prettyLogFormat)
	if err != nil {
		return nil, err
	} else if len(stderr) > 0 {
		return nil, errors.New(string(stderr))
	}
	return parsePrettyFormatLog(stdout)
}

// GetCommitsByRange returns certain number of commits with given page of repository.
func GetCommitsByRange(repoPath, branch string, page int) (*list.List, error) {
	stdout, stderr, err := com.ExecCmdDirBytes(repoPath, "git", "log", branch,
		"--skip="+base.ToStr((page-1)*50), "--max-count=50", prettyLogFormat)
	if err != nil {
		return nil, err
	} else if len(stderr) > 0 {
		return nil, errors.New(string(stderr))
	}
	return parsePrettyFormatLog(stdout)
}

// GetCommitsCount returns the commits count of given branch of repository.
func GetCommitsCount(repoPath, branch string) (int, error) {
	stdout, stderr, err := com.ExecCmdDir(repoPath, "git", "rev-list", "--count", branch)
	if err != nil {
		return 0, err
	} else if len(stderr) > 0 {
		return 0, errors.New(stderr)
	}
	return base.StrTo(strings.TrimSpace(stdout)).Int()
}
